Using the remote control

You can use the enclosed wireless remote control to control this device.
When using the remote control, please aim at the device's remote control
sensor, located on the front of the device. A 30 degree angle is recom-
mended for best operation.
Note:
• Objects between the remote control and the sensor window may prevent
proper operation.
• Similar remote controls could interfere with the function of the recorder.
• Make sure not to store the remote control upside down or with any
objects pressing on the buttons - this could drain the battery.

Cautions regarding use of remote control

• Please do not expose the remote control to shock and liquids and do not
place it in areas with high humidity. Do not install or place the remote con-
trol under direct sunlight, as the heat may cause deformation of the unit.
• When the remote sensor window is exposed to direct sunlight, it may not
work properly. If so, please operate the remote control closer to the
remote sensor window or change the angle of the lighting or device.

Important notes about the battery

• If the unit is not used for a longer period of time, we recommend you to
remove the battery.
• Please do not use batteries other than specified. Improper use of batter-
ies can result in a leakage of chemicals and/or explosion.
• In case of any leakage of the battery, dispose of the battery right away
and avoid touching the chemical discharge. Make sure to clean the
remote control's battery compartment before installing a new battery.
